<h2 class="class">Type TrustRoot</h2>
<pre class="base-tree">
<a href="__builtin__.object-class.html"><code>object</code></a> --+
|
<b>TrustRoot</b>
</pre><br />
<hr/>
This class represents an OpenID trust root. The <code><a
href="openid.server.trustroot.TrustRoot-class.html#parse"
class="link"><code>parse</code></a></code> classmethod accepts a trust
root string, producing a <code><a
href="openid.server.trustroot.TrustRoot-class.html"
class="link"><code>TrustRoot</code></a></code> object. The method OpenID
server implementers would be most likely to use is the <code><a
href="openid.server.trustroot.TrustRoot-class.html#isSane"
class="link"><code>isSane</code></a></code> method, which checks the
trust root for given patterns that indicate that the trust root is too
broad or points to a local network resource.

<a name="isSane"></a>
<table width="100%" class="func-details" bgcolor="#e0e0e0"><tr><td>
<h3><span class="sig"><span class="sig-name">isSane</span>(<span class=sig-arg>self</span>)</span>
</h3>
This method checks the to see if a trust root represents a
reasonable (sane) set of URLs. 'http://*.com/', for example is not a
reasonable pattern, as it cannot meaningfully specify the site claiming
it. This function attempts to find many related examples, but it can
only work via heuristics. Negative responses from this method should be
treated as advisory, used only to alert the user to examine the trust
root carefully.
<dl><dt></dt><dd>
<dl><dt><b>Returns:</b></dt>
<dd>
Whether the trust root is sane
<br /><i>
(type=<code>bool</code>)</i>
</dd>
</dl>
</dd></dl>
</td></tr></table>
